00The world of professional sports and entertainment is about to collide in a spectacular way as Chau Tuyet Van, famously known as the 'Hot Girl of Taekwondo,' officially joins the cast of 'Sisters Who Make Waves 2024' (Chi Dep Dap Gio 2024). This announcement has sent ripples of excitement through both the athletic community and the entertainment industry, marking a significant career pivot for one of Vietnam’s most decorated martial artists. Chau Tuyet Van is not just a household name for her striking beauty; she is a world-class athlete with an impressive collection of gold medals from international competitions, including the SEA Games and World Taekwondo Poomsae Championships. Her discipline, agility, and fierce determination on the mat are now being channeled into a completely different arena: the performing arts stage.
'Sisters Who Make Waves' has become a cultural phenomenon, known for bringing together successful women from various backgrounds to showcase their talents in singing, dancing, and stage performance. For Chau Tuyet Van, participating in the 2024 season represents a bold challenge to step outside her comfort zone. While fans are used to seeing her in a traditional dobok delivering powerful kicks, they are now eager to see how her athletic grace translates into choreography and vocal performances. Her involvement brings a unique dynamic to the show, highlighting the versatility of modern female icons who refuse to be defined by a single label.
